Human Phenotype Ontology (HPO) gene set. This set contains genes that have been annotated to the HPO term "Myoclonic absence seizure", which is defined as "Myoclonic absence seizure is a type of generalized non-motor (absence) seizure characterised by an interruption of ongoing activities, a blank stare and rhythmic three-per-second myoclonic movements, causing ratcheting abduction of the upper limbs leading to progressive arm elevation, and associated with 3 Hz generalized spike-wave discharges on the electroencephalogram. Duration is typically 10-60 s. Whilst impairment of consciousness may not be obvious the ILAE classified this seizure as a generalized non-motor seizure in 2017."
